Wondering why a race car looks like it’s trying to take up the whole track? Our feature “Why does a racing car have a wide base?” breaks it down in plain language. A wider stance pushes the car’s centre of gravity lower, which means less wobble in fast corners and more grip when the speed climbs. In short, the car stays planted and you stay in control.
